Groups
Quiz
Login
Register
Search
adjective
1
of
1
Good
/
Pleasure
audio
delectable
-
(of food or drink) delicious
The wedding cake looked so
delectable
that the bride almost wanted to hurry up with the ceremony just so she could have a slice.